Decades after their 1984 All Valley Karate Tournament bout, a middle-aged Daniel LaRusso and Johnny Lawrence find themselves martial-arts rivals again.

I know I'm a film fan and what I'm about to say will sound insane but here goes: I haven't seen The Karate Kid. I know, I know, I know. It's on my watch list. So I didn't really have the nostalgia for the original movie coming into the TV show but I was pleasantly surprised. 

​

Thirty four years after events of the 1984 All Valley Karate Tournament, a down-and-out Johnny Lawrence seeks redemption by reopening the infamous Cobra Kai dojo, reigniting his rivalry with a now successful Daniel LaRusso.

​

The beginning of the series shows the effect that the loss at the 1984 All Valley Karate Tournament had on Johnny Lawrence. It completely devastated him, cutting who he was down at the knees. Its an interesting direction for a series to go; exploring what defeat can do to a person and how it can radically change the whole axis of their world.

​

There are times where the production really does feel like a TV show from a decade ago in the sets, colour grading, and some of the acting choices but overall Cobra Kai is a great show of redemption against the odds. 

​

Although its not as slick as other TV productions out there, Cobra Kai is a great show of redemption against the odds.
